In `XeF_2`, Xe is `sp^3d` hybridized but the shape is linear. Explain

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

This is because Xe has two bond pair of electron and three lone pair of electrons. Bond pair of electrons determines the shape.

Quantum mechanical calcuations show that mathematical mixing of certain combinaaation of orbitals in a given atom forms hybrid orbitals. The spatial orientations of these new orbitals lead to more stable bonds and are consistent with the observed molecular shapes . The process of orbital mixing is called hybridization and the new atomic orbitals are called hybrid orbitals.- Conditions (i) The no. of hybrid orbitals equal the number of atomic orbitalsmixed. (ii)The type of hybrid orbitals obtained varies with the type of atomic orbitals mixed. Rules to determine hybrid orbitals. Method i:Count no .of atoms directiy attached to central atom + lone pairs+single electrons. Method II: Count sigma - bonds+co-ordinate bonds+ lone pair+single electrons. If the number comes one to be 2 implies sp 5 implies sp^3d/dsp^3 3 implies sp^2 6 implies sp^3d^2/d^2sp^3 4 implies sp^3/dsp^2 7 implies sp^3d^3 Answer the following questions based on above passage : Phosphorous pentachloride in gaseous state exists as a momomer.
